English Language Arts
- The child demonstrated their ability to create and develop fictional characters by writing about a cheetah family.
- They practiced using descriptive language to paint a vivid picture of the cheetah family's habitat and adventures.
- The child learned how to structure a story with a clear beginning, middle, and end, as they developed the plot for their cheetah family.
- Through writing dialogue for the cheetah characters, the child practiced using quotation marks and punctuation correctly.
Encourage your child to further develop their writing skills by exploring different genres or styles. They could try writing a poem about cheetahs, or create a comic strip featuring the cheetah family. Encourage them to experiment with different narrative techniques, such as writing from the perspective of a different animal in the story. Encouraging creativity and providing opportunities for self-expression will help your child continue to grow as a writer.
